The Power Of 360 Assessments In Driving Personal And Professional Growth

In today’s fast-paced and competitive business environment, the need for continuous personal and professional development has never been greater One powerful tool that organizations are increasingly turning to in order to facilitate growth and improvement among their employees is the 360 assessment

A 360 assessment, also known as a 360-degree feedback assessment, is a comprehensive tool that provides feedback from multiple sources including supervisors, peers, subordinates, and even oneself This holistic feedback allows individuals to gain a well-rounded perspective on their performance, behaviors, and competencies, enabling them to identify strengths, weaknesses, and areas for improvement.

The concept of 360 assessments is based on the belief that individuals often have blind spots when it comes to evaluating their own behavior and performance By gathering feedback from a variety of perspectives, individuals can gain a more accurate and comprehensive understanding of how they are perceived by others and where they can focus their efforts to drive personal and professional growth.

One of the key benefits of 360 assessments is that they provide individuals with actionable feedback that they can use to create a personalized development plan This feedback can help individuals set specific goals, identify areas for improvement, and track progress over time By having a clear roadmap for growth, individuals can take concrete steps to enhance their skills and capabilities, ultimately leading to improved performance and increased job satisfaction.

Furthermore, 360 assessments can also help individuals enhance their self-awareness and emotional intelligence By receiving feedback on their interpersonal skills, communication style, and leadership abilities, individuals can gain insights into how their behavior impacts others and identify opportunities for growth This increased self-awareness can lead to improved relationships, greater empathy, and more effective collaboration with colleagues.

Despite the many benefits of 360 assessments, it is important to recognize that they are not without their challenges One common concern is the potential for bias or inaccuracies in feedback, particularly if individuals providing feedback have personal biases or agendas To mitigate this risk, it is essential that organizations design and implement 360 assessments in a thoughtful and transparent manner, with clear guidelines for confidentiality, anonymity, and data protection.

Another challenge of 360 assessments is ensuring that individuals are receptive to feedback and willing to take ownership of their development Some individuals may feel threatened or defensive when receiving feedback, particularly if it highlights areas of weakness or areas for improvement It is important for organizations to foster a culture of open communication and continuous feedback, where individuals feel supported and encouraged to learn and grow.
